NFL Betting – Patriots Could Dominate NFL Fantasy Season

The last time that the New England Patriots went out and acquired a Pro Bowl wide receiver via trade they went on to set a league record with 18 straight wins to open their season before falling short in the Super Bowl. That NFL betting lines season the Patriots’ offense set all sorts of records, and after landing Chad Ocho Cinco and rookie running back Stevan Ridley in the offseason, New England’s offense should be among the most dangerous in the NFL once again.

The addition of Ocho Cinco gives the Patriots the outside presence they need to team with Deion Branch, which allows Wes Welker to work in the middle where he is the most effective. Ridley is a dangerous playmaker between the tackles, and with Aaron Hernandez continuing to develop into one of the best playmaking tight ends in the league, New England will let it fly. The San Diego Chargers and Green Bay Packers are another couple of teams to keep an eye on in terms of complete NFL fantasy potential. Both teams have a ton of depth with playmakers such as Vincent Jackson and Greg Jennings making things much easier for Philip Rivers and Aaron Rodgers respectively. As far as running backs are concerned, keep an eye on Minnesota Vikings’ star Adrian Peterson to have another huge year, while Stephen Jackson works with a lot more room for a revamped St. Louis Rams’ offense. Any of those players could rank as elite fantasy stars heading into this year, and it should make for an exciting sports betting season.
